I have been slowly coming up to speed on lttng. 

 

I think I am almost there (At least with regard to getting my kernel
ready). 

 

I am using 2.6.21.1 (Right from kernel.org) with lttng 0.9.5. 

 

I applied the patches, and am now attempting to  configure/compile the
kernel. 

 

When I do a make xconfig, I DO see the lttng options under the
Instrumentation tree and I select them. 

 

When I go to compile though, I see the following warning. 

 

ltt/Kconfig:271:warning: 'select' used by config symbol
'LTT_PROCESS_STACK' refer to undefined symbol 'UNWIND_INFO'

ltt/Kconfig:271:warning: 'select' used by config symbol
'LTT_PROCESS_STACK' refer to undefined symbol 'STACK_UNWIND'

 

Is this a problem ? I am looking through the kernel configuration files
to see where the 2 missing symbols are, so far I have only found them in
the lttng patch/KBuild files.
